Web9 Jun 2024 · When compared to halogen light bulbs, LEDs win hands down on cost. On average, a halogen light bulb lasts around 2,000 hours, which is approximately two years of average use. LEDs, however, last for around 25,000 hours, delivering savings for consumers for years and years whilst also reducing physical waste. WebThe power required to operate an installed light fitting (or luminaire) is measured as a rated Wattage (Watts being Joules of energy per second). The rated wattage of a light source refers to the entire power consumed in creating the light Lumens and includes the: Energy required in creating "visible" light emitted from the lamp

WebWhich means the electric current that powers your lights – any lights – switches backwards and forwards 50 times each second. We didn’t used to notice it with our old incandescent bulbs, because the bulb’s residual heat kept the filament glowing between flickers. This was a side-effect of the inefficiency of traditional bulbs.
